Description: this cut paper project has a lot of color, the balloons are popping out at you, Realistic, has balloons, mountains, created with cut paper and foam, colored pencils
Analysis: this pieces has texture in the mountains which help add to the realism. It also has movement with the hot air balloons floating in the sky. Also there is also unity with the repetition of the hot air balloons in the sky.
Interpretation: in this piece I was inspired by a family friend artist. She painted a few paintings of hot air balloons and I saw them and decided to draw hot air balloons for my cut paper project. To create the 3-d look I made sure to color the hot air balloons as if they were 3-d and I added foam to the back of them to make them pop out.
Judgement: I loved the idea for this project and I’m mostly happy with how it turned out but I feel like I could of added more to it to make it look more realistic and have less empty negative space. I could have added some clouds or even more mountains.

My piece is a mahi fish swimming in the water. It was made with blue green and yellow water colors. It has more of a cartoon look to it than realistic. The principals of design for this fish are movement and balance. The fish has movement due to it swimming in the water and the water behind the fish has movement also. The piece is very balanced with the fish being right in the middle of the page which also brings your eyes to it. The elements of art used were color and texture. The fish was made with water colors so it is very colorful all over. The fish has texture on its body that makes it look a little bit more realistic like a real fish. The color of this piece bring a a very energetic happy mood to people. When they see the fish since it has bright colors they can feel happy and energetic instead of maybe sad if there were dark colors. I personally fell that I did pretty good job on this piece. I have never used water color before so it was fun to try something new. Some strengths would be the texture added to the fish’s body and the overall out line of the fish. Some weaknesses were the blending of the water colors on the fish and the water drops in the background.

5/10 Kolesa p.5 typography project 
Description:
My piece is simple with some color. It has a main focus on the words sunshine and shadow. The sun and the cloud have a gradient affect on them and are not completely colored in.
Analysis:
In this piece I used contrast between the fancy font and normal simple font. Also there is balance with the sun on one side and then the clouds balancing on the other side. When someone is looking at the piece their eyes go towards the fancy font in gold first. Another principal I used was texture in the words sunshine and shadows.
Interpretation: I chose this quote from Helen Keller because it reminds us that if we look towards the happier things in life we won’t even notice the bad things that could have happened. It is a good reminder that life shouldn’t be focused on negative things but positive things. I added a sunshine and storm cloud to represent the sunshine and the shadows in life.
Judgement: I really like how this project turned out. I’m glad that I used the sunshine and cloud as examples for the quote. I also love how the words sunshine and shadows turned out and I’m glad I made them pop out. Hopefully when people see it, it will make them remember to look more towards the good things happening rather than the bad things.
